How to install and connect: Step-by-step workflow

Getting set up is straightforward once you know the sequence. First, install the Sony Headphones Connect app from Google Play or the App Store. Then enable Bluetooth on your phone, and put your Sony headphones into pairing mode. Open the app and follow the on-screen prompts to add the headset. If needed, you can also pair via your phone’s Bluetooth settings by selecting your Sony headphones from the available devices. After pairing succeeds, check the app for a firmware update and install it if available. Finally, save a sound profile that matches your environment and test playback with a few tracks to confirm the changes. Remember to keep the app updated to access new features and presets as they are released.

Common issues and troubleshooting

Bluetooth pairing problems are common but usually fixable with a few checks. Ensure the headphones are sufficiently charged and in pairing mode, and confirm the app has all necessary permissions (location, storage, Bluetooth). If the app cannot find the device, toggle Bluetooth off and on, restart the app, or reboot your phone. Some users experience delay or audio dropouts when the phone is connected to multiple devices; remove other nearby Bluetooth devices or disable Bluetooth on nonessential devices. Firmware mismatches can also cause instability; always update through the app when possible. As a fallback, you can remove the headset from your device’s saved Bluetooth list and re-pair from scratch. If issues persist, consult Sony’s support page or Headphones Info analyses for model-specific guidance.

Alternatives if the official app is unavailable

If the official app cannot be installed or is not supported on your device, you can still pair Sony headphones using standard Bluetooth settings. Pairing through the system menu will allow basic audio playback, but you may miss advanced controls and firmware updates. Some users also explore manufacturer-provided desktop software or third-party apps, but these options may void warranties or reduce compatibility. For most users, the recommended path is to borrow a compatible device temporarily to install the official app and complete the setup there.
